These days, it's better to be safe than sorry. You can't tell if someone is infected or not just by looking at them. HIV/AIDS can take 3 months or more to be detected, and can be transmitted to others in the meantime.

Even if a BG has been tested, the results would only be valid for the date the test was done. She could have dozens of partners between the time she was tested and when the results come in. Not sure how much faith I would have in those quicky saliva tests I've heard about.

Just like gambling, you pay your money, you take your chances.

BG's don't want to get infected anymore than than anyone else, but some will take the risk if money is involved. From what I've read, the problem in Thailand isn't as bad as it is in Africa, yet.

Bar girls - as a group - can't be forced to undergo HIV testing. That would be a violation of their human rights. :o

There are government figures for HIV in some high risk groups, such as drug users seeking treatment, but the most reliable figures for the population as a whole come from the army's testing of conscripts. But I don't think those figures would tell you much about HIV prevalence in Bangkok bar girls.

Use a condom if you are worried. Even if your sleeping partner tested negative last week, she could still be infected and it wouldn't show on the test for 3-6 months. And if she's HIV+, she may well continue working. She'll need income for medication and just to survive.
